Overview of 1995 Chevrolet Corvette ZR-1 For Sale by Owner

Do you ever wish you could go back in time 30 years? With this 1995 Chevrolet Corvette ZR-1, 30 years ago is today. Showing only 27 miles, this example remains a true time capsule that looks, feels, and even presents as though it has just rolled off the showroom floor. Original paper tags, factory paint dabs, and marker inspection marks remain visible throughout the engine bay and undercarriage, preserving the authenticity of what may be one of the most original and lowest-mileage C4 ZR-1 examples known. While every ZR-1 represents an important chapter in Corvette history, this particular example is suited for the collector seeking a benchmark-level representation of Chevrolet’s “King of the Hill” performance flagship. The final production year for the C4 ZR-1, 1995 saw only 448 examples produced, and this car is documented as number 352. Adding to its significance is its rare dual Dunn head configuration, a feature reportedly found on only 130 later-production 1995 ZR-1 models. According to accompanying documentation, this combination makes this example exceptionally rare, with its 27-mile odometer reading making it an especially unique piece of Corvette history. Documented with a clean Carfax, original window sticker still attached to the windshield, second window sticker, build sheet, ZR-1 owner’s manual packet, Corvette literature, factory accessories, and additional documentation, this Corvette represents an extraordinary opportunity to preserve one of Chevrolet’s most technologically advanced performance cars of the era.

Engine

Powering this 1995 Chevrolet Corvette ZR-1 is the legendary 5.7L naturally aspirated LT5 V8, an all-aluminum 32-valve DOHC engine developed through Chevrolet’s collaboration with Mercury Marine. The fuel-injected LT5 remains one of the most significant engines in Corvette history, featuring a unique cam cover design and advanced engineering that helped establish the ZR-1 as a world-class performance car. This example benefits from the rare dual Dunn head configuration and represents the later 1995 specification. Paired with a 6-Speed Manual transmission and rear-wheel drive, the LT5 helped propel the ZR-1 to legendary status, including multiple international speed and endurance records achieved during its development, such as a 24-hour endurance run averaging 175.885 mph over 4,221.256 miles. Equipped with the ZR-1 Special Performance Package, Selective Ride & Handling System, and its documented 27-mile history, this Corvette remains a remarkable representation of Chevrolet and Mercury Marine engineering at its peak.
